We educate, support, and advocate for foster, kinship and adoptive children, youth and families in central Missouri by offering services and partnering with others to help them become healthy and self-sufficient.
The Meyer family came to us in 2019 seeking to become a licensed foster/adoptive family. They participated in our STARS preservice training, CPR, and Spaulding adoption training. After becoming licensed they welcomed children into their home with open arms. They took the placement of three sibling teens, an infant, and three natural children of their own.
